The first part of the school gives an introduction to quantum ergodicity. It will consist of three lecture series:


Ingo Witt
(Göttingen)

Introduction to semiclassical analysis
Frédéric Faure
(Grenoble)
Ergodicity of quantum maps
Roman Schubert
(Bristol)

Quantum ergodicity on negatively curved manifolds

and single talks by participants.

The school will have a second part to be held in Göttingen in Fall 2012 that revolves around applications of quantum ergodicity to harmonic analysis. More information will follow shortly.
